  | MaterialCreateInstanceCore Method  | 
            When implemented in a derived class, creates a new instance of the 
Material 
            derived class. 
            
 
Namespace: DigitalRune.GraphicsAssembly: DigitalRune.Graphics (in DigitalRune.Graphics.dll) Version: 1.2.0.0 (1.2.1.14562)
Syntaxprotected virtual Material CreateInstanceCore()
Protected Overridable Function CreateInstanceCore As Material
protected:
virtual Material^ CreateInstanceCore()
abstract CreateInstanceCore : unit -> Material 
override CreateInstanceCore : unit -> Material 
Return Value
Type: 
MaterialThe new instance.
Remarks
            Do not call this method directly (except when calling base in an implementation). This 
            method is called internally by the Clone method whenever a new instance of the
            Material is created. 
            
Notes to Inheritors: Every Material derived class must 
            implement this method. A typical implementation is to simply call the default constructor 
            and return the result. 
            
See Also